The abstract submission system for the the 6th 3E Conference – ECSB Entrepreneurship Education Conference to be in Enschede, The Netherlands on 16th – 18th May 2018 is now open. The submission deadline is 1 December 2017.
Following the format launched at 3E 2016, the conference is a 3-day event starting with a practitioner day on Wednesday 16 May. There are two calls, one for research papers and the other for practitioner development workshops (PDWs). Each author can appear in maximum of 2 abstracts/proposals. Regardless of the submission, the focus should be still on questions, challenges and problems.
Conference theme: Entrepreneurschip ecosystems – engaged scholarship and living labs
Sub-themes:
• Entrepreneurship education for non-business students
• Entrepreneurial “classrooms”
• Social and civic entrepreneurship education
• Pedagogical theories in entrepreneurship education
• Online and blended-learning approaches
• Engagement, impact and evaluation
• Innovations in assessment
• Values, ethics and critiques of entrepreneurship education
• Learning philosophies in entrepreneurship education
• Gender perspectives in entrepreneurship education
• Entrepreneurial universities
• Student incubator initiatives
• Entrepreneurship education policy
• Case studies in entrepreneurship education
